Java: The Classic Language
Java has been a central player in Android development since the platform's inception in 2008. Known for its robustness and portability, Java has stood the test of time. It's like that reliable old car that just keeps running, year after year.
-
Legacy and Ecosystem: Java boasts a vast ecosystem. With countless libraries and frameworks, developers can find tools for almost any need. Plus, there's a treasure trove of community support and documentation available online.
-
Compatibility: One of Java's strengths is its backward compatibility. Developers don't have to worry much about their code breaking with new updates. This stability makes it appealing for long-term projects.
But, like anything that's been around for a while, Java has its quirks. Its syntax can sometimes feel verbose, making code longer and more complex than it needs to be. So, is it still the best choice in 2023?
Kotlin: The Modern Alternative
Enter Kotlin, a language officially endorsed by Google for Android development in 2017.Â
It's like the new kid on the block, bringing energy and excitement to the table.Â
Kotlin was developed to address the shortcomings of older languages, offering a fresh take on Android programming.
-
Conciseness and Simplicity: Kotlin code is typically more concise than Java. It allows developers to express ideas without getting bogged down in verbose syntax. This means fewer lines of code, which can translate to fewer bugs.
-
Interoperability: One of Kotlin's standout features is its seamless interoperability with Java. You can call Java code from Kotlin and vice versa. This makes it easy to adopt Kotlin in existing Java projects.
-
Safety and Modern Features: Kotlin introduces null safety, a common headache for Java developers. Additionally, it offers features like coroutines for handling asynchronous code, which are not inherently available in Java.
With its modern flair and developer-friendly features, Kotlin is gaining ground rapidly. It offers a breath of fresh air for those looking to write cleaner, more efficient code.

Syntax and Readability
One of the first things you'll notice about Kotlin is its cleaner syntax.Â
The language is designed to be crisp and to the point, like a well-edited script.Â
Kotlin often requires fewer lines of code than Java, which can make it easier to read and maintain.Â
For instance, consider how Kotlin handles simple tasks like finding lengths of strings or initializing lists.Â
It's like switching from writing a letter by hand to typing it with auto-correct—the syntax can help you focus on your ideas rather than getting bogged down in the nitty-gritty.
Here’s an example of how Kotlin's concise syntax makes life easier:
-
Java Example:
List<String> list = new ArrayList<>(); list.add("Hello");
-
Kotlin Example:
val list = listOf("Hello")
Null Safety
Kotlin is like a strict parent when it comes to nulls—it simply doesn’t allow lazy behavior that leads to NullPointerExceptions.Â
In Java, forgetting to check if an object is null can cause your app to crash spectacularly.Â
Kotlin prevents this by making all variables non-nullable by default, unless you explicitly declare them as nullable using a question mark (?
).Â
This built-in null safety adds a layer of protection, helping programmers avoid common pitfalls and keep applications running smoothly.
Extension Functions
Sometimes you wish you could add a new feature to your favorite app without changing its core code. Kotlin lets you do just that with extension functions. You can think of these like app plugins that bring in new features to existing classes without altering the original files. Developers can add these enhancements with a simple syntax, allowing rapid prototyping and innovation.
For example, want to add a function to calculate the area of a circle to the Double
class? Easy:
- Kotlin Example:
fun Double.area() = Math.PI * this * this
Interoperability
Teamwork makes the dream work, and Kotlin is designed to play well with Java. If you’ve got an existing Java project and want to add some Kotlin flair, there’s no need to start fresh. Kotlin's interoperability ensures that it can call Java code and vice versa, like a bilingual person navigating between languages. This seamless integration allows developers to introduce Kotlin gradually into their codebase without having to rewrite everything from scratch.
Performance
When it comes to performance, both languages run on the JVM and have comparable speeds.Â
However, Kotlin sometimes edges out Java in certain scenarios due to its modern syntax and features.Â
Memory usage is typically similar, but Kotlin’s syntactic sugar can sometimes lead to more efficient code.Â
That being said, the performance differences often boil down to specific use cases and how well the code is written rather than which language you choose.

Choosing Java for Legacy Projects
When maintaining legacy Android applications, Java often becomes the go-to language. Why? It's like your old pair of shoes—worn-in, reliable, and familiar. Here are a few reasons Java might be the better choice:
- Established Codebase: Many older apps are built on Java. Sticking with it can save time and avoid compatibility issues.
- Widespread Support: Java has a vast community. Finding solutions and patches for potential issues is usually easier.
- Stability: With years of updates and improvements, Java's stability is hard to beat for projects that rely on tried-and-true frameworks.
In essence, when dealing with the past, Java provides consistency and reliability that new projects might not need, but legacy ones demand.
Choosing Kotlin for New Projects
Starting fresh? Kotlin is like a bright new gadget, packed with tools that make your development experience innovative and efficient. Here are scenarios where Kotlin shines:
- Conciseness: Kotlin reduces boilerplate code, making your codebase clean and manageable. This means fewer lines, less room for errors, and more time for creativity.
- Modern Features: Its adaptability with modern programming paradigms offers seamless integration with the latest tech trends. Think of it as upgrading your toolkit.
- Interoperability: Kotlin works smoothly with Java. It allows developers to mix both languages seamlessly, leveraging the best of both worlds.
For new apps, Kotlin is a powerful choice, offering modern features that can swiftly address today's programming needs.Â
It's like driving a new car with all the latest features, providing speed and efficiency on the road to successful app development.
